A batch of 28 satellites for the Starlink mega-constellation - SpaceX's project for space-based Internet communication system.
STARLINK-35601 was lifted into orbit during the mission ‘Falcon 9 Block 5 | Starlink Group 11-12’, on board a Falcon 9 space rocket.
The launch took place on Oct. 25, 2025, 2:20 p.m. from Space Launch Complex 4E.
